Transaction e8659f2686b2b3c7593f397442eac0addae0ae5af1a8ef66a8d3215b0381ca11

1 Input
2 Outputs
  • e8659f2686b2b3c7593f397442eac0addae0ae5af1a8ef66a8d3215b0381ca11:0
  • value  22767589
    address  14a3dE2smNciJwH6vee8sEE85p5mvKLSTH
  • e8659f2686b2b3c7593f397442eac0addae0ae5af1a8ef66a8d3215b0381ca11:1
  • value  10000
    address  38uYndMai8gnUwZNGBaMgnjeVke2qwVDsG